本指南旨在帮助读者掌握挖掘机程序的编写技巧。内容涵盖了从基础知识到高级应用的全面指导,包括挖掘机的控制原理、编程语言和工具选择、程序设计和调试等方面。本指南不仅介绍了编写挖掘机程序的基本步骤,还详细解析了在实际操作中可能遇到的常见问题及解决方案。通过阅读本指南,读者可以了解并掌握挖掘机程序编写的核心技能,从而更加高效、安全地进行挖掘机的操作和维护。
本文目录导读:
挖掘机程序编写是一个涉及复杂机械操作与自动化控制的过程,随着科技的进步,挖掘机操作逐渐实现智能化,编写挖掘机程序的需求也日益增长,本文将详细介绍挖掘机程序编写的过程,包括需求分析、设计思路、编程语言和具体实现等方面。
需求分析
在编写挖掘机程序之前,首先要明确需求,需求分析是软件开发过程中的重要环节,对于挖掘机程序编写同样适用,具体需求包括:
1、功能需求:明确挖掘机的功能要求,如挖掘、装载、移动等。
2、性能需求:对挖掘机的性能进行规定,如挖掘速度、装载效率等。
3、安全性需求:确保挖掘机在操作过程中的安全性,避免事故发生。
4、兼容性需求:确保程序能够在不同的挖掘机型号和操作系统上运行。
设计思路
在明确需求后,接下来是设计思路,挖掘机程序设计需要遵循以下原则:
1、模块化的设计思想:将挖掘机程序划分为不同的模块,如控制模块、传感器模块、执行模块等,便于后期维护和升级。
2、人机交互设计:考虑操作人员的习惯,设计简洁明了的操作界面,提高操作效率。
3、安全性考虑:在设计过程中,要充分考虑安全因素,如设置急停按钮、过载保护等。
编程语言选择
在编写挖掘机程序时,选择合适的编程语言至关重要,常用的编程语言包括C语言、C++、Java等,这些语言具有强大的功能,可以满足挖掘机程序的需求,具体选择哪种语言,需根据项目的需求、开发团队的熟悉程度以及挖掘机的硬件环境来决定。
具体实现
1、初始化程序:在程序启动时,进行初始化操作,包括初始化硬件接口、设置默认参数等。
2、传感器数据采集:通过传感器采集挖掘机的实时数据,如角度、速度、压力等。
3、控制算法实现:根据采集的数据,通过控制算法计算控制量,如电机转速、液压压力等。
4、人机交互界面:设计简洁明了的操作界面,方便操作人员控制挖掘机。
5、安全保护机制:设置安全保护机制,如过载保护、急停功能等,确保挖掘机的安全。
6、调试与优化:在程序编写完成后,进行调试与优化,确保程序的稳定性和性能。
注意事项
1、安全性:在编写挖掘机程序时,要始终牢记安全性原则,确保挖掘机的安全。
2、兼容性:考虑程序的兼容性,确保程序能够在不同的挖掘机型号和操作系统上运行。
3、文档编写:在编程过程中,要编写相应的文档,方便后期维护和升级。
4、代码规范:遵循编码规范,提高代码的可读性和可维护性。
5、团队协作:在团队中协作开发,充分利用各自的优势,提高开发效率。
案例分析
以某型号挖掘机程序编写为例,具体介绍编程过程,该案例涉及功能需求、性能需求、安全性需求等方面,在编程过程中,采用了模块化设计思想,将程序划分为控制模块、传感器模块、执行模块等,选择了合适的编程语言进行开发,并设计了简洁明了的操作界面,在编程过程中,充分考虑了安全性,设置了急停功能、过载保护等,进行了调试与优化,确保程序的稳定性和性能。
本文详细介绍了挖掘机程序编写的过程,包括需求分析、设计思路、编程语言和具体实现等方面,在实际应用中,需要根据具体需求选择合适的编程语言和开发环境,充分考虑安全性、兼容性和文档编写等方面,随着科技的进步,挖掘机程序编写将越来越智能化,未来可期待更多创新的应用场景和技术应用。
参考资料
[请在此处插入参考资料]
附录
[请在此处插入附录]
就是挖掘机程序编写的相关内容,希望通过本文的介绍,读者能够对挖掘机程序编写有更深入的了解,在实际应用中,需要根据具体情况进行具体的分析和设计,不断积累经验,提高编程技能。